Medvode
Medvode is a town and the seat of the Municipality of Medvode in the traditional region of Upper Carniola in Slovenia. It lies northeast of Ljubljana along the Sava River and is part of the Central Slovenia Statistical Region. The town functions as an administrative, commercial, and transport hub for the surrounding area and serves as a commuter link to the capital region.
